Valuable minerals are extracted from rock via the process of comminution (crushing and grinding). In the mining and mineral processing sector, most energy use and greenhouse gas emissions derive from comminution, separation (froth flotation) and concentrate drying. A number of auxiliary materials handling operations are also considered a branch of mineral processing such as storage (as in bin design), conveying, sampling, weighing, slurry transport, and pneumatic transport. The efficiency and efficacy of many processing techniques are influenced by upstream activities such as mining method and blending.

Mineral processing, art of treating crude ores and mineral products in order to separate the valuable minerals from the waste rock, or gangue. It is the first process that most ores undergo after mining in order to provide a more concentrated material for the procedures of extractive metallurgy.

18/11/2013· A shortage of "rare earth" metals, used in everything from electric car batteries to solar panels to wind turbines, is hampering the growth of renewable energy technologies. Researchers are now working to find alternatives to these critical elements or better ways to recycle them.
